xuyoulin 发表于 2012-4-10 10:32:52

不同支护应力场模拟

请教:FLAC如何才能有效实现不同支护强度应力场的区别和规律

xuyoulin 发表于 2012-4-10 10:47:55

new
plo blo gro
gen zon brick p0 0 0 0 p1 100 0 0 p2 0 50 0 p3 0 0 6 size 50 25 3 group meiceng
gen zon brick p0 0 0 6 p1 100 0 6 p2 0 50 6 p3 0 0 11 size 50 25 5 group xishayandingban
gen zon brick p0 0 0 11 p1 100 0 11 p2 0 50 11 p3 0 0 50 size 50 25 20 group shayandingban
gen zon brick p0 0 0 -20 p1 100 0 -20 p2 0 50 -20 p3 0 0 0 size 50 25 10 group diban

;建模完成
   
   save moxing.sav
   rest moxing.sav

plo con szz

m m

;煤层
pro density 1550 bulk 1.6e9 she 0.9e9 fric 30 coh 2.7e6 ten 0.85e6 range group meiceng

;底板
pro density 2520 bulk 2e9 she 1.2e9 fric 33 coh 8e6 ten 4e6 range group diban

;顶板
pro density 2700 bulk 10e9 she 6e9 fric 30 coh 14e6 ten 5.2e6 range group xishayandingban
pro density 2700 bulk 10e9 she 6e9 fric 30 coh 14e6 ten 5.2e6 range group shayandingban
      ;setting initial conditions
;
      ini xdisp 0 ydisp 0 zdisp 0
      ini xvel 0 yvel 0 zvel 0
      ini state 0


;setting boundary conditions
      fix x range x -0.01 0.01
            fix x range x 99.99 100.01
               fix y range y -0.01 0.01
                  fix y range y 49.99 50.01
                     fix z range z -20.01 -19.99

;设置重力参数
   set grav 0 0 -10

   apply szz -13.045e6 range z 49.99 50.01
;H=520
    ;assign initial stress state
      ini szz -13.045e6
            ini sxx -4.97e6
               ini syy -9.15e6
      solve
             save ini.sav
             rest ini.sav

plot con szz
model null range x 20 24 y 0 35 z 0 4
    def bolts
             k=0.5
                j=0.9
                   k2=35
                loop while k<k2
                                             
command
;
               sel cable id=1 begin 18 k 0.2 end 20 k 0.2 nseg=6   ;左侧5根
               sel cable id=1 begin 18 k 1.1 end 20 k 1.1 nseg=6
                        sel cable id=1 begin 18 k 2 end 20 k 2 nseg=6
                        sel cable id=1 begin 18 k 2.9 end 20 k 2.9 nseg=6
                        sel cable id=1 begin 18 k 3.8 end 20 k 3.8 nseg=6

                        sel cable id=1 begin 20.2 k 4 end 20.2 k 6.2 nseg=6   ;顶板5根
               sel cable id=1 begin 21.1 k 4 end 21.1 k 6.2 nseg=6
               sel cable id=1 begin 22 k 4 end 22 k 6.2 nseg=6
               sel cable id=1 begin 22.9 k 4 end 22.9 k 6.2 nseg=6
               sel cable id=1 begin 23.8 k 4 end 23.8 k 6.2 nseg=6
               
               sel cable id=1 begin 24 k 0.2 end 26 k 0.2 nseg=6   ;右侧5根
               sel cable id=1 begin 24 k 1.1 end 26 k 1.1 nseg=6
               sel cable id=1 begin 24 k 2 end 26 k 2 nseg=6
               sel cable id=1 begin 24 k 2.9 end 26 k 2.9 nseg=6
               sel cable id=1 begin 24 k 3.8 end 26 k 3.8 nseg=6

               sel cable prop emod 1e11 ytens 8.39e4 xcarea 2.54e-4 &
                              gr_coh 1.3e5 gr_k 7e9 gr_per 1.0 range id=1
               sel cable pretension 50e4 range id=1
               end_command
               k=k+j
               end_loop
                                                   
               end
               bolts
solve
   save 掘进50KN修改.sav

以上是我写的一个简单的模型,但是改变预紧力以后也体现不出煤岩体周围应力场的区别,希望能得到高手的指点,不胜感谢!

xuyoulin 发表于 2012-4-10 16:16:41

怎么就没有人给点帮助啊。。。。。:'(

xuyoulin 发表于 2012-4-14 22:02:17

是所有人都不知道怎么实现。还有高人不愿意说啊?

xuyoulin 发表于 2012-4-15 11:53:41

又做了一些相关条件的模拟,区别还是不大,,,希望有懂的高人出来指点一二

wangjun1988 发表于 2014-8-4 16:16:35

支护应力场只存在大牛的论文里

jackjia1988 发表于 2014-12-18 11:21:53

我也正在学,求份程序,602498845@qq.com

mahoubao 发表于 2014-12-20 18:01:39

好赞啊   
页: [1]
查看完整版本: 不同支护应力场模拟